Confidence Is A Gift December 27, 2017 Happy Holidays, Memes, Motivation, Positivity Hope you are enjoying the Holiday Season! I keep learning more about how belief is a gift that keeps on giving. Share Tags: believe in yourself, hilarious, holidays, powerful, santa, santa claus Categories Happy Holidays, Memes, Motivation, Positivity Previous Home for the HolidaysNext Buyer Aware!